Actuary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$36.73 | $293.83 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$44.69 | $357.48 |
| Median (P50) | $58.61 | $468.86 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$75.02 | $600.13 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$90.85 | $726.78 |

Hourly Rate Trajectory for Actuaries in Savannah (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.20% projection.
| Year | Hourly Rate |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$47.33/hr | Actual |
| 2020 | $48.50/hr | Actual |
| 2021 | $46.26/hr | Actual |
| 2022 | $49.80/hr | Actual |
| 2023 | $52.42/hr | Actual |
| 2024 | $54.85/hr | Actual |
| 2025 | $56.79/hr |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$58.61/hr | Estimated |
| 2027 | $60.48/hr |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, the median hourly rate for actuaries in Savannah grew 20.0% from $47.33/hr (2019) to $56.79/hr (2025). At a 3.20% projected growth rate, hourly pay is expected to reach $60.48/hr by 2027. Part-time and per-diem actuaries can use this multi-year trend to benchmark future contract negotiations.

Working as an Hourly Actuary in Savannah
For those contemplating part-time actuarial work in Savannah, understanding the potential earnings is crucial. A 24-hour workweek translates to a yearly income significantly below full-time colleagues, who typically benefit from greater stability and benefits. Per diem actuation, although less common at the junior level, often commands hourly rates of $250-$500 for consulting engagements, particularly for FSA and FCAS credentialed professionals. Moreover, engaging in expert witness testimony can lead to impressive billing rates ranging from $400 to $800 per hour. Different employer types, from life and health insurance companies to property and casualty insurers, offer varied pay scales; while firms like Mercer and Aon may provide higher hourly rates, they often come without the benefits offered by insurers. As such, negotiators should consider the trade-offs between hourly pay and the benefits package. Understanding how to articulate your value to potential employers in Savannah can enhance your negotiation strategy, particularly as actuaries are increasingly expected to possess analytics and consulting skills alongside traditional actuarial expertise.
